[Kernel-packages] [Bug 1318218] Re: SATA problems on MacBook Pro 11, 1?

2014-07-31 Thread Alex
Further to my earlier comment, it seems that these settings don't entirely eliminate SATA errors. I've tried with both "medium_power" and "min_power" as settings for the link_power_management_policy, and still get some errors. They're slightly different, and also less regular; around 10 every 5 min
